Clinical Nurse Manager 2 - Complementary Therapy
Lead the delivery of complementary therapies and have a pivotal role in managing the provision of complementary therapies to children/teens and their carers within the Haematology/Oncology setting.
Communicate and work closely with all Haematology/Oncology staff including the Palliative Care team.
Identify needs in relation to the development of complementary therapies and coordinate the introduction of other appropriate therapies.
Address issues of quality, training, audit, research and the delivery of complementary therapies.
Liaise with other complementary Therapists/Centre\'s of Excellence regarding training and development of complementary therapies.
Essential Criteria
Be registered on the Children's Division and/or the General Division of the Register of Nurses & Midwives maintained by the Nursing and Midwifery Board of Ireland
AND Have at least 5 years post registration experience of which 2 must be within an acute paediatric hospital setting
AND Qualification in a complementary therapy which includes at least one of the following: massage, reflexology, and/or aromatherapy at a diploma of higher education or degree level
AND Experience in complementary therapies involving children
AND Have the clinical, managerial and administrative capacity to properly discharge the functions of the role
AND Demonstrate evidence of continuing professional development at the appropriate level
